Baby sleeps for around 16 hours every day, so it's crucial to ensure that their sleep environment is secure. A properly assembled, maintained, and used crib can reduce the risk of sudden infant cot bed death syndrome (SIDS) as well as suffocation and entrapment. To avoid gaps or crevices which could trap a baby crib, cribs should be equipped with slats that are no more than 2.4 inches apart.

Cribs are designed to adapt as baby grows, and cribs that have multiple mattress support height levels is a fantastic feature. This lets you to lower the mattress as your child gets older and keeps him from climbing out.
